Wearing a mask is one of our best defenses against Covid, it’s not exactly a good way to avoid maskne, dryness, and other skin problems. And with the colder weather and drier air approaching with fall, our skin could definitely need a little extra love. Fortunately, Seattle has a plethora of beauty retailers and local skin care brands dedicated to everything from sunscreen and moisturizer to gentle cleansers and beyond.

An oil-based cleanser can help your skin maintain its balance instead of removing all natural oils. This one from local brand French Girl is rich in antioxidants, vitamin E and fatty acids, and uses ingredients like jojoba, tamanu and sunflower seed oils, as well as argan, rose oil. musky and rose geranium.
